Actually I can't do any modding for a few days now, because thanks to SI I can't open Oblivion.esm in the old CS. If I use the new CS that can open it, then you guys won't be able to use it unless you too have the new CS. I should have renamed the file first, but I honestly didn't think Bethseda would be stupid enough to just have the expansion edit the old esm. I thought they would have done what everyone else does and made an additional esm. *sigh*

Can the old esm be hex edited like you do with a DLC esp so the old CS can read it?

To fix this problem you need to make a back-up of the Oblvion .esm and use that as the masterfile in place of the OB .esm, then once you are finished, in the hex editor, change the filename dependency to Oblivion.esm. To edit it again, you need to change the file name in the hex editor again, otherwise you will find it will then become dependant on the OB SI version (Which is why you have to be certain you are finished first).

The Old CS, can still open new CS files (I think), and everyone should update to the new CS anyway, nothing stopping people that don't have it from getting it from the ES site I dunno
